Subject:Shoxs Billard Lounge - Operation of the Boulevard Cafe at 2827 Dundas Street
West (Davenport)
Purpose:
To report on the operation of the boulevard cafe at 2827 Dundas Street West as requested
by City Council at its meeting of April 16, 1998.
Funding Sources, Financial Implications and Impact Statement:
Not applicable.
Recommendation:
That the temporary licence for the boulevard cafe fronting 2827 Dundas Street West be
extended to the end of the 1998 cafe season under the present terms and conditions and I be
requested to report back after the end of the 1998 cafe season on the operation of the cafe.
Background:
City Council, at it's meeting of April 16, 1998, granted permission for the applicant to erect
a temporary patio subject to:
(1)the Commissioner of Works and Emergency Services reporting to the meeting to be held
by the Toronto Community Council on June 24, 1998, on any problems with the
establishment at 2827 Dundas Street West;
(2)the owners being prohibited from playing music on the patio or having any music
emanating from within the cafe;
(3)the patio being closed and cleared by 11:00 p.m.; and
(4)the owners installing and maintaining garbage and recycling receptacles.
Comments:
A temporary cafe licence (expiry date June 31, 1998) for the cafe at 2827 Dundas Street
West was issued to Mr. Konstantinos (Gus) Koutoumanos on May 25, 1998. Although Mr.
Koutoumanos has erected his cafe fence, he has not operated the cafe due to cool weather
conditions.
Conclusions:
Given that the cafe has not operated to-date and the temporary licence will expire on June
30, 1998, it may be appropriate to issue a temporary cafe licence until the end of the 1998
cafe season and I be requested to monitor the cafe operation during the 1998 cafe season and
report back to the Toronto Community Council at the end of the 1998 summer cafe season
on the operation of the cafe for consideration as a deputation item. All conditions of
previous approval will continue to be applied.
